Top Trends in Modern Lifestyle for 2025

The way people live and work is always changing. Each year, new trends appear that affect how we eat, work, travel, and spend our free time. In 2025, modern lifestyles are becoming more balanced, healthy, and connected with technology. Let’s explore the top trends that are shaping life this year.

1. Health and Wellness Are a Priority

In 2025, people are paying more attention to their health than ever before. Simple habits like eating fresh food, exercising regularly, and meditating have become popular. Yoga and home workouts are gaining more followers, while fitness apps are helping people track their health. Mental health is also important. Many people now use online therapy, meditation apps, and stress-relief exercises to stay calm and positive.

2. Sustainable Living Is Growing

People are becoming more aware of how their choices affect the environment. In modern lifestyles, sustainability is a key trend. Many families are reducing plastic use, recycling more, and choosing eco-friendly products. Solar energy, electric vehicles, and energy-saving appliances are becoming common in homes. Even small changes like using reusable bags or avoiding fast fashion are now part of daily life.

3. Technology and Smart Homes

Technology is making life easier and more comfortable. Smart home devices like voice assistants, smart lights, and automatic temperature controls are popular in 2025. Wearable devices like smartwatches track health, sleep, and fitness. Even kitchens and living rooms are becoming smart, saving time and energy for busy families. Many people also work remotely using laptops, apps, and video calls, making flexible work a standard part of modern life.

4. Travel and Experience Over Things

Experiences are more important than buying things. In 2025, people spend money on travel, learning new skills, and enjoying hobbies rather than material products. Short trips, weekend getaways, and eco-tourism are very popular. Adventure tourism, cultural trips, and nature retreats are also on the rise as people look for unique memories instead of possessions.

5. Minimalism and Simple Living

Simple living has become a major lifestyle trend. Many people are choosing to live with fewer belongings and declutter their homes. Minimalism is about focusing on what is truly important—time, relationships, health, and experiences. This trend helps reduce stress and allows people to enjoy life without unnecessary distractions.

6. Personalized and Flexible Work Life

Modern work trends in 2025 focus on flexibility and personalization. Many companies allow remote work, hybrid schedules, or flexible hours. People can work from home, cafes, or co-working spaces. This trend gives workers a better balance between work and personal life, reducing stress and improving productivity.

7. Plant-Based and Healthy Food Choices

Healthy eating is one of the top lifestyle trends in 2025. Plant-based diets, organic foods, and low-processed meals are becoming more popular. Many people now prefer fruits, vegetables, and grains over meat-heavy diets. Healthy eating is not just for physical health but also for mental well-being. Nutrition apps and food trackers help people make better choices.

8. Learning and Self-Improvement

Continuous learning is a key trend in modern life. People are taking online courses, learning new languages, and improving skills through apps and digital platforms. Self-improvement is not just for students but for adults too. Many people spend time on creative hobbies, personal growth, and learning skills that improve their careers.

Modern lifestyles in 2025 are all about balance, health, sustainability, and technology. People want to live better, smarter, and more consciously. Trends like wellness, smart homes, minimalism, plant-based food, flexible work, and meaningful experiences are shaping the way we live. These changes show that modern life is moving toward simplicity, health, and happiness, while staying connected with the world through technology.
